PRODUCT DESCRIPTION:
Carboplatin is a platinum-based chemotherapeutic agent used extensively in the treatment of a variety of solid tumors.
It interferes with DNA replication and transcription in rapidly dividing cancer cells, providing high efficacy with a more favorable toxicity profile than its predecessor, Cisplatin.

Therapeutic Indications:
- Ovarian Cancer (first-line and recurrent)
- Lung Cancer (non-small cell and small cell)
- Head and Neck Cancers
- Testicular Cancer
- Off-label: Endometrial, bladder, and esophageal cancers, as per treatment protocols
Side Effects:
- COMMON:
- Nausea and vomiting
- Myelosuppression (especially thrombocytopenia)
- Fatigue
- Electrolyte imbalance
- Mild nephrotoxicity
- SERIOUS (RARE):
- Severe bone marrow suppression
- Hypersensitivity reactions (including anaphylaxis)
- Ototoxicity
- Liver enzyme elevations
- Renal impairment (less common than cisplatin)
- PRECAUTIONS:
- Dose adjustment required in renal impairment (based on AUC dosing)
- Monitor blood counts and renal function during therapy
- Use under strict oncological supervision
- Contraindicated in patients with severe bone marrow depression
- Use caution in elderly or debilitated patients
